Five years ago, Literary Editors Africa began with a straightforward purpose. It was created to help writers refine their stories and present their best work to the world. What started as a basic idea, grounded in a deep respect for language and storytelling, has grown into a space where writers and editors come together to turn ideas into clear, compelling, and meaningful narratives.

Over the years, we have had the privilege of working with a wide variety of writers. Some were emerging voices taking their first bold steps, while others were seasoned authors honing their craft. We have also collaborated with institutions aiming to improve the quality of their publications. Each manuscript carried its own world, rhythm, and truth. Being trusted with these stories has been both an honour and a responsibility that we cherish.

This journey has been influenced by the changing literary landscape in Africa. More writers are discovering their voices, and more platforms are emerging to share diverse stories. Within this growth, editing has remained central to our work. It is not just a technical process; it involves listening, understanding, and refining while keeping the writer’s voice intact.

The past five years have taught us important lessons. Every manuscript requires patience. Every writer’s journey is unique. Clarity often comes through teamwork and trust. We have grown through challenges, responded to changes, and continued to strengthen our commitment to quality and integrity in every project we take on.

As we celebrate this milestone, we do so with gratitude. We are thankful to the writers who have trusted us with their work. We appreciate the partners who have joined us on this journey. We also recognize everyone who believes in the power of well-told stories.

Five years later, our commitment remains the same. We will continue to walk alongside writers, honour their voices, and help shape stories that deserve to be read.
